Your team
Pictet Wealth Management combines more than 200 years of Swiss banking heritage with global investment expertise. The Partner-owned financial services group offers a comprehensive range of services for wealthy individuals and families, including discretionary and advisory investment solutions, and family office services.
As a Client Relationship Officer, you will be responsible for all operational aspects of daily banking activities. Your role will be to deliver a world-class client experience.
Your role

Serving as the point of entry for all operational requests from bankers or clients.

Leading the end-to-end account-opening process, taking the local regulatory specificities that determine documentation requirements into consideration.

Ensuring a strict follow-up of documentation (including pendings, middle office andR&C lists) by contacting clients, in coordination with the banker in charge of the relationship.

Managing documentation flows (archiving and processing physical and electronic forms).

Leading KYC information-gathering where required, and updating supplementary records in the system when needed.

Processing workflow requests in the system (client codifications, credit card requests, credit lines, pricing exceptions, etc.) and ensuring relevant client documentation is entered into the system (memos, orders, etc.).

Coordinating closely with the zone’s Business Risk Manager to resolve any risk and compliance matters.

Leading and organising, within the team, the prioritisation and remediation of any Key Risk Indicators flagged.

Adhering to all existing policies and directives, and support the implementation of new ones where needed.

Processing payments and transfers, while ensuring callbacks are systematically performed, and providing support for other transactional activities where needed.

Fostering close ties with the relevant internal stakeholders (Voyages, Middle Office, R&C, etc.), learning about what they do and acting as their point of contact for the team.

Ensuring telephone call coverage within the team.

Supporting administrative tasks where required.
Your profile

Bachelor's degree or similar.

No less than 5 years’ experience in a similar role.

Fluent in English, Spanish and Portugues; French is an advantage.

Service orientated, with expertise in dealing with private clients and supporting relationship managers.

Firm grasp of wealth managers’ client documentation duties and related internal processes.

Familiarity with regulatory dimensions (cross-border, R&C, PEP, CARA, FATCA, CRS etc.).

Attention to detail.

Able to work independently and diligently.

Reliable and resilient, with a strong sense of responsibility and an ability to multi-task.

Solution-oriented and proactive mindset.

Excellent communication and presentation skills, both written and oral.

Strong team spirit.
